What is the e signed copy
An e signed copy refers to a document that has been electronically signed using an eSignature solution. This process allows individuals and businesses to sign documents digitally, ensuring authenticity and integrity. An e signed copy is legally binding in the United States, provided it meets specific criteria outlined in the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ce (ESIGN) Act and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A). These laws validate the use of electronic signatures in commercial transactions, making e signed copies a secure and efficient alternative to traditional paper documents.

Legal use of the e signed copy
The legal use of an e signed copy is supported by federal and state laws in the U.S. Under the ESIGN Act and UETA, electronic signatures hold the same legal weight as handwritten signatures, provided certain conditions are met. These include the intent to sign, consent to do business electronically, and the ability to retain a copy of the signed document. Businesses must ensure compliance with these regulations to validate their e signed copies in legal contexts.
Key elements of the e signed copy
Key elements that contribute to the validity of an e signed copy include:
- Intent to sign: The signer must demonstrate a clear intention to sign the document.
- Consent: All parties involved must agree to use electronic signatures.
- Authentication: Measures should be in place to verify the identity of the signer.
- Record retention: A copy of the signed document must be accessible for future reference.

Examples of using the e signed copy
e signed copies are used across various industries for different purposes. Common examples include:
- Real estate agreements, where buyers and sellers sign contracts electronically.
- Employment documents, such as offer letters and non-disclosure agreements.
- Financial forms, including loan agreements and tax documents.
- Legal contracts, where parties can sign agreements without the need for physical meetings.
